Git Product home page Git Product logo

seichiassist's Introduction

SeichiAssist

CircleCI

開発環境

前提プラグイン

前提プラグイン(整地鯖内製)

ビルド

//TODO maven -> gradle へ移行済みの為、書き変えが必要。

前提プラグインのjarを${プロジェクトディレクトリ}/localDependenciesにコピーしてください。

Gradleがコマンドラインで使える状態でgradle buildを実行すると、targetフォルダにjarが出力されます。

// TODO Eclipse Eclipseを開発に使用している場合、プロジェクトをgradleプロジェクトとして読み込み、 実行(R) -> 実行(S) -> Maven Clean を実行 そのあと、実行(R) -> 実行(S) -> Maven Install を実行 すればtargetフォルダにjarが出力されます。

IntelliJ IDEAを開発に使用している場合、プロジェクトをgradleプロジェクトとして読み込み、 GradleタブからTasks -> build -> jarを実行すればbuild/libフォルダにjarが出力されます。

DBの準備

初回起動後、DBが作成されますが、ガチャ景品およびMineStackに格納可能なガチャ景品のデータがありません。その為、以下SQLdumpをインポートしてください。

JavaDocs

publicなメソッドについては、JavaDocsを記載するよう心がけてください。 その他は各自が必要だと判断した場合のみ記載してください。

Commit Style

1コミットあたりの情報は最小限としてください。 コミットメッセージは英語の動詞から始めることを推奨しています。

Branch Model

Git-flowを簡略化したものを使用します。 新規に機能を開発する際は develop ブランチから feature-<任意の文字列> ブランチを作り、そこで作業してください。 開発が終了したらdevelopブランチにマージします。 masterブランチは本番環境に反映されます。 本番環境を更新するタイミングでdevelopブランチをmasterブランチにマージします。

利用条件

  • GPLv3ライセンスでの公開です。ソースコードの使用規約等はGPLv3ライセンスに従います。
  • 当リポジトリのコードの著作権はunchamaが所有しています。
  • 独自機能の追加やバグの修正等、当サーバーの発展への寄与を目的としたコードの修正・改変を歓迎しています。その場合、ギガンティック☆整地鯖(以下、当サーバー)のDiscordコミュニティに参加して、当コードに関する詳細なサポートを受けることが出来ます。

seichiassist's People

Contributors

cressonleaf avatar crosshearts avatar ga2ku avatar hsjoihs avatar karayuumac avatar kassikun2012 avatar kaworukomine avatar kisaragieffective avatar kory33 avatar lucky3028 avatar megatron577 avatar siro256 avatar taaa150 avatar tar0ss avatar tennitimc avatar unchama avatar unixpf avatar yuki256r avatar yukukotani av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.